About the role
As Electrical Engineer, you will manage corrective and preventive maintenance including troubleshooting, checking and repairing systems and equipment either in the Main Plant or in Hotel Services on a rotational basis.
Responsibilities
- Complete the monthly maintenance routines and report all completed work on the preventive maintenance system.
- Provide professional and social guidance to team members.
- Perform corrective and preventive maintenance, including troubleshooting, checking and repairing on Main Plant or Hotel systems.
- Perform installation and maintenance of electric wiring and related equipment around the entire ship.
- Assigned to an "On Call" rotating system.
- Emergency Duties as specified in the ship Assembly Plan.
- Uphold the general safety management responsibilities in areas and operations under your control.
Qualifications
- Valid ETO CoC
- 2+ years' shipboard experience as Electro-technical Officer
- Fluent written and spoken English
- Enthusiasm about guiding other team members
